#be1f44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be1f44 is composed of 74.5% red, 12.2%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.7%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 346 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 43.3%. #be1f44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e88 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#be1f44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be1f44 has RGB values of R:190, G:31,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.64,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12459844.

Shades and Tints of #be1f44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f5 is the lightest one.
